Best Other Asian, 2007: Monsoon Wok & Lounge
Monsoon features Asian fusion cuisine and an array of creative cocktails.  
By OnMilwaukee.com Staff Writers

Published Oct. 26, 2007 at 5:15 a.m.
Tags: monsoon, other asian, mi-key's, johnny vassallo, mo's, bd's mongolian barbecue, west bank cafe, phan's garden, noodle house, genghis khan, saigon, asiana, han kuk kwan

The votes are in and the winners have been selected for OnMilwaukee's Best: Eat & Drink, 2007. The results of this readers' poll, including an editors' pick, are available in this series of articles that run all October long during Dining Month on OnMilwaukee.com.

For the second time in a month, Monsoon Wok & Lounge has made headlines here at OnMilwaukee.com.

Three weeks ago, we brought you the story of the restaurant's exit from the Mo's family. Johnny Vassallo sold his interest to Michael H. Polaski, owner of Mi-Key's Downtown and one of Monsoon's initial investors.

Today, we can tell you that Monsoon, located at 17800 W. Bluemound Rd., is the winner in our 2007 readers' poll in the Other Asian category.

Monsoon, which features a fusion menu and an array of Tiki-inspired cocktails, withstood a strong challenge from the runner up, BD's Mongolian Barbecue near Bayshore Town Center.

With its Downtown location closed (and the building at 811 N. Jefferson St. now occupied by Mi-Key's), Monsoon is focusing on the Brookfield location and possible expansion to other cities.
